YMCA Camp Jones Gulch is a residential summer camp operated as a branch of the YMCA of San Francisco. Located in the redwoods of the Santa Cruz Mountains near La Honda, California, the camp serves diverse youth and families through outdoor-based programs that emphasize discovery, leadership, and social connection, welcoming visitors from the Bay Area and supporting partnerships with local outdoor education initiatives. Founded in 1934, it sits on a large property and focuses on youth development, healthy living, and social responsibility within the civic and social organizations sector. The camp hosts a variety of activities and experiences designed to foster confidence, peer respect, and community building, with a reach of thousands of participants annually across its residential programs, family events, and related partnerships. In recent years, the organization has pursued initiatives and collaborations within the broader YMCA ecosystem, including intergenerational outdoor programming and community partnerships.
